Output ecd63c804f5132399fa225b0412650533891cd07278370c9855baa95f26c4a18:0

value
2893840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 766190e540becee4aa7134e7daebf798dbb97387 OP_EQUAL
address
3CUxYBdgx1SeYCCYEBsviK747bWPKHj6Pj
transaction
ecd63c804f5132399fa225b0412650533891cd07278370c9855baa95f26c4a18